"Faithful Chosen" of Santiago

Faithful Chosen of Santiago This banner was commissioned by the youth band "Fieles Escogidos" (Faithful Chosen) of Santiago, Spain. The lettering mirrors their latest CD cover and the rock textured background and yellow arrow reflect "The Way of St James".

The 3rd largest Christian pilgrimage route in the world was signed for centuries by yellow paint brushed onto rocks along the pilgrimage route to show the way pilgrims were meant to walk. This arrow is pointing upwards to "The Way" - just as the lyrics of their songs and their lives point to Jesus.

The banner was created to be taken on an evangelistic 7 day pilgrimage as 30 passionate Spanish youth walked and shared with thousands of pilgrims from all over the world on the way to the "Celebration of Praise" in Santiago de Compostela, August 14th 2004.
